The timezone in Paphos is UTC+2, which is 6 hours ahead of Washington DC. Paphos International Airport is located in Paphos.
Get to the airport on time so you don't miss your flight from Washington DC to PFO. Be there at least two hours ahead for international flights and an hour early for domestic departures to prevent a last-minute sprint to your gate.
With more people on the move during busy months like July, be at your terminal even earlier. Two hours for domestic flights and up to four for international journeys will help you deal with longer queues. Remember things also get busy during major holidays like July Fourth.

The best time to fly from Washington DC to Paphos International Airport (PFO)
April is the quietest time of year to travel to Paphos. Alternatively, join the crowds and visit in July. This is the most popular month for flights from Washington DC to Paphos International Airport.
Schedule your flight from Washington DC to PFO for August if you're eager to explore the city during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ures in Paphos to range from 23ºC to 32ºC.
If you like cooler conditions, look for a cheap flight from Washington DC to Paphos International Airport in February when temperatures average between 9ºC and 18ºC.

There are so many things to explore in this city it can be hard to work out where to begin. Tombs of the Kings, Kato Paphos Archaeological Park and Paphos Harbour Castle are highlights which should feature on any well-planned Paphos itinerary.
